Description: PGAdmin: SQL Query Editor does not (always) open files
Details:

Reproduction scenario:
1- Open PGAdmin III(v1.8 or 1.10) and connect to a server
2- Click on the "SQL/pen" icon to launch the "Execute arbitraty SQL Queries"
window
3- In this new window, choose File / Open and open a sql file (choose not to
save the existing content of the window)

In some cases (almost every time on my case) the file does not load and the
windows still shows its previous content.

This can occurs at the first load of a file, or more frequently when loading
another SQL file.

I tried PGAdmin III v1.8.4 and 1.10.1 and got the same problem.
I then tried v1.6.3, and this time I did not get the error
